A Coveted Modern Issue
The American Gold Eagle series, first introduced in 1986, quickly became a cornerstone of modern U.S. coinage. Featuring Augustus Saint-Gaudens' iconic Liberty design, originally used on the early 20th-century Gold Double Eagle, these coins symbolize American ideals and craftsmanship. This 2017-W edition is particularly notable due to its West Point Mint origin and exceptional condition.

Collecting Considerations
To preserve its pristine condition, handle this PCGS MS70 Gold Eagle with care. Store it in a safe, climate-controlled environment, preferably within its protective holder. The PCGS certification guarantees its authenticity, but always compare the certification number against the PCGS database for added assurance.
